About L. Peter Sarin

L. Peter Sarin is a scholar working on Ecology, Molecular Biology and Cancer Research, having authored 21 papers that have together received 570 ind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include RNA and protein synthesis mechanisms (9 papers), RNA modifications and cancer (8 papers) and Bacteriophages and microbial interactions (6 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Endocrinology (56 citations), Molecular Biology (391 citations) and Infectious Diseases (58 citations). L. Peter Sarin has collaborated with scholars based in Finland, United Kingdom and Germany. Frequent co-authors include Dennis H. Bamford, Sebastian A. Leidel, Minna M. Poranen, Cha San Koh, Christian Fufezan, Hannes C. A. Drexler, Alberdina A. van Dijk, Antti Aalto, Urmas Arumäe and Märt Saarma. Their work appears in journals such as Nucleic Acids Research, The Journal of Immunology and Journal of Virology.
